Inside the band, where the top is a tie

The top systems on our naturalness column overlap on their 95% intervals. Inside that group there is no ranking to win — the intervals cross, so ordering them reads noise. What matters is whether a voice is in the band. Flux is, on day one.

Money, decimals and ordinals: perfect

Our robustness axis asks whether a voice says the right words for a number, a date, an amount or an operator. An HTTP 200 cannot see any of this — a system reading “dollar sign one comma two three four” returns a perfectly successful response.

currency10/10large numerals10/10decimals10/10ordinals10/10times9/10dates3/10
Sixty fixtures, spokenForm off so the voice sees raw glyphs. Dates is the one category that separates systems on this axis, and it is where Flux loses points.

Currency, large numerals, decimals and ordinals came back correct on every fixture.

Flux keeps the minus sign. Given -$12.50 it says “negative twelve dollars and fifty cents”, and both independent transcription oracles agree:

Several systems on this board drop that sign entirely. It is the single heaviest penalty our scoring applies, because a lost minus turns a refund into a charge. Flux does not make that class of mistake, and that is the one to care about.

Where it does slip

Two categories cost it points. Both are worth hearing rather than taking on trust.

On numeric date forms, Flux reads the digits without saying the month. 07/15/2026:

Written with the month spelled out, it is correct — “We close on December 24th”:

So this is specific to the numeric form, not to dates. And it is provisional: on the confirmation pass both oracles returned the written form 07/15/2026, which cannot show whether the voice said “July” or “oh seven”. Every published claim on this axis is reproduced three times across independent oracles, and this one is not settled.

The other is a hyphenated range. 08:00-20:00 came back as “eight twenty” from both oracles — the range collapsed into a single time:

Both are recoverable. A caller who hears “seven fifteen twenty twenty-six” can still act on it, and both are fixable upstream by verbalising dates and ranges before they reach the voice. Neither inverts a value.

What it is actually for

Flux is built for voice agents, and the API is honest about that. Interrupt it and it returns the text the caller actually heard, split from the text they did not, so agent context can be reconciled after a barge-in instead of guessed at. Prosody carries across turns on its own.
